Transaction 59771a6152a6bf6901c356fcb29622ea707735ab8dfe33e6b6654991c51aa047

1 Input
2 Outputs
  • 59771a6152a6bf6901c356fcb29622ea707735ab8dfe33e6b6654991c51aa047:0
  • value  496600
    address  39rfUD6ZjyHUpvr9F1gjxEPLEdwTSqzrTQ
  • 59771a6152a6bf6901c356fcb29622ea707735ab8dfe33e6b6654991c51aa047:1
  • value  943100
    address  1B3BNdQDpyGLLbwoGbdTmHiFxS3xsBDyam